Palm, PA demographics:
population, income, and more
Palm population
How many people live in Palm
Palm is home to 223 residents, according to the most recent Census data. Gender-wise, 60.5% of Palm locals are male, and 39.5% are female.
Age demographics
Adults between 25 and 44 make up 4.5% of the population, while another 45.3% fall into the 45 to 64 bracket. Finally, around 50.2% are 65 or older.

Households in Palm
A peek inside Palm households
Palm has 145 households, with an average of 2 members in each. Of these, 49.7% are families, while the remaining 50.3% are made up of individuals living alone or with non-relatives, such as roommates.
Households stats
Housing in Palm
The housing landscape of Palm
Palm's housing consists of 145 units, with 93.1% being detached single-family homes ideal for those wanting space.
The age of buildings in Palm
In Palm, the median construction year is 1955. Most development happened in the second half of the 20th century.
Palm occupancy rates
Out of the 145 occupied housing units in Palm, 87.6% are owner-occupied, while 12.4% are lived in by tenants.

Education in Palm
Palm education at a glance
About 67.3% of the population in Palm went to high school, while 12.1% pursued college studies. Another earned an associate degree and 11.7% hold a bachelor’s. Meanwhile, 9% went even further, earning a master’s or doctorate.
Income in Palm
How much people earn in Palm
The average annual household income in Palm was $79,291 in 2024, the most recent annual data available, according to the U.S. Census Bureau. This marked a +0.5% change from the previous year. At the same time, the median income stood at $74,638, reflecting a +3.5% shift over the same period.
Palm income by age
Those with someone between 45 and 64 in charge, often well established professionally, earn $74,901 overall. Overall, 100% of the locals in this community live above the poverty line.
Employment in Palm
Workforce and job types in Palm
62.1% of the working population are employed in professional or administrative positions, while 37.9% are in hands-on or service-based jobs. Also, 19.3% run their own businesses, 75.7% are employed by private companies, and 5% work in the public sector.
Workforce demographics
Transportation in Palm
How people get around in Palm
Commuting methods vary: 93.9% of residents travel by personal vehicle and 6.1% prefer to walk, while the remaining share relies on public transit or on two wheelers to get from A to B.
